White House Cracks Down on Chip Sales to China

Posted on October 9, 2022August 27, 2023 By bot

The Biden administration on Friday announced limits on exporting semiconductor technology to China. The restrictions from the US Commerce Department’s Bureau of Industry and Security are meant to slow the progress of Chinese military programs. .
